Output e9015e580193ed91a58426414cd5afe0233ebd02ae5d9e4af50917de5cf70e9b:0

value
422400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b49e5a3a096020927eea0f70f9b772b3414cbc OP_EQUALVERIFY OP_CHECKSIG
address
145Dfvqf7jN6G4SEJga6tYFEjFBKey6ULy
transaction
e9015e580193ed91a58426414cd5afe0233ebd02ae5d9e4af50917de5cf70e9b
confirmations
320667
spent
true